Epidemiological surveillance in the Provence-Alpes-Côte d'Azur region. Update as of May 17, 2023.

Key Points

COVID-19

  • Decrease in viral circulation.

  • Other epidemiological indicators are stable or declining to low levels.

Chikungunya, Dengue, Zika

  • Enhanced surveillance for cases of chikungunya, dengue, and Zika began on May 1.

  • Since surveillance began, 7 imported dengue cases have been identified, mainly among travelers returning from the French West Indies (Guadeloupe and Martinique).

Pollen

  • High allergy risk in the Provence-Alpes-Côte d'Azur region, mainly due to grass and olive tree pollen.
